y=-3
slope of zero means the line is flat, horizontal with a constant y value
just set y equal to the y coordinate of the given point (4,-3). Ignore the x coordinate, 4. y=-3 is the equation with slope zero through (4,-3)
or
try doing the slope point form of a linear equation
(y- -3) = 0(x-4) = 0
y+3 =0
y =-3
